1. Understanding Modern Minimalist Living Room Decor
1.1 Key Concepts
Modern minimalist decor is characterized by simplicity, clean lines, and a restrained color palette. It focuses on creating a tranquil and clutter-free environment that emphasizes functionality and aesthetics. This style often incorporates natural light, open spaces, and a limited number of carefully selected pieces of furniture and decor.
1.2 Important Terminology
- Minimalism: A design style that promotes simplicity and functionality, eliminating excess and focusing on what truly matters.
- Sleek Interior Design: The use of smooth, clean surfaces and streamlined shapes to create a sophisticated and uncluttered look.
- Cozy Minimalism: A subset of minimalist design that prioritizes comfort and warmth within the simplicity and elegance of minimalism.
2. Step-by-Step Guide to Creating a Modern Minimalist Living Room
2.1 Step 1: Declutter Your Space
The fundamental principle of minimalist living is to live with less. Start by decluttering your living room. Remove items that do not serve a purpose or do not enhance the aesthetic. Consider donating or selling excess furniture and accessories.
2.2 Step 2: Choose a Neutral Color Palette
Neutral colors are the backbone of a minimalist design. Opt for shades such as white, beige, gray, and soft pastels. These colors create a calming atmosphere and serve as a perfect backdrop for more vibrant accent pieces.
2.3 Step 3: Select Functional Furniture
Choose furniture that is both practical and stylish. Look for pieces with clean lines and a modern aesthetic, such as a sleek sofa or a simple coffee table. Multipurpose furniture, like a storage ottoman, is an excellent choice for maintaining a tidy space.
2.4 Step 4: Embrace Natural Light
Natural lighting is essential in a minimalist living room. Opt for large windows or sheer curtains to allow as much natural light as possible. If natural light is limited, use a combination of different light sources, such as floor lamps or pendant lights, to brighten the space.
2.5 Step 5: Add Minimalist Decor Elements
Choose a few decor items that complement the minimalist aesthetic. Think of simple art pieces, a statement rug, or a few indoor plants to add life to the room. Remember, less is more, and each piece should have a purpose or tell a story.
3. Practical Tips for a Cozy Minimalist Living Room
3.1 Embrace Texture
While minimalist design is often associated with sleek surfaces, incorporating various textures can add depth and warmth to a room. Consider using materials like wool, cotton, and knits to create inviting and cozy textures.
3.2 Personalize with Subtle Details
Your living room should reflect your personality and lifestyle. Personalize your space with small, meaningful details such as family photos in simple frames or a beloved book displayed on a shelf. Keep these elements subtle to maintain the minimalist aesthetic.
3.3 Keep It Green
Indoor plants are a staple in minimalist design and can significantly enhance the coziness of your living room. They not only purify the air but also add a touch of nature to the environment. Choose low-maintenance plants, such as succulents or peace lilies, to effortlessly incorporate greenery into your decor.
